Ardmore is a charming and vibrant suburb located in the Lower Merion Township, Pennsylvania, in the United States of America. It's well-known for its blend of urban and suburban living, offering residents an excellent quality of life. One of the standout features of Ardmore is its rich history which is evident in its architecture, especially noticeable in the residential areas where old Victorian and colonial-style homes are common. The Ardmore Historic District is listed on the National Register of Historic Places and is a testament to the town’s historical significance. Ardmore is also a hub for shopping and dining. The Suburban Square is one of the main shopping destinations in Ardmore. It is an upscale outdoor shopping center that offers a unique blend of high-end retail shops, restaurants, and fitness centers. Stores such as Apple, GAP, Trader Joe's, and Anthropologie are just a few of the big names you'll find here.
